Daniel Schumaker
If you don’t have much of a standard for Chinese takeout, I could see you enjoying this. It certainly is food. But their fried goods are absolutely soaked and dripping in oil, and their meats are so dry. I’ve never gotten food from them that tasted fresh. The rice was dry and crunchy. Overall it’s just not up to my standards. There are a lot of places in West Michigan that offer better food at the same price and are more authentic. This really is just American food. I like the staff a lot, they’re always friendly and they are always quick to get you you’re food. I hate leaving such a negative review when they’ve been so nice but the food just isn’t up to snuff. Sorry Hunan, but until you step up your game in terms of quality, two stars is the best I can give you I hope one day this place turns around because I love this area and only live a two minute drive away. But I would tell people to avoid eating here and instead go to Lai Thai Kitchen just a couple blocks away. They really put this place to shame.
